Contributors Of The Week 2023-05-22
This week we're recognizing bwarden.
Since 2007, he's maintained a collection of POI files for TriMet and other transit systems, mostly around the Portland Oregon area.
This past month, in addition to updating several existing files, he added a new file for the Tualatin Shuttle service.
Thank you bwarden for sharing and keeping these files up-to-date over all these years.

Wow, Waze asked to stop using “shortcuts” for routing
Interesting concept, a North Caroline town has asked Waze to stop routing traffic in some areas of the town.
